Why Traditional VoC Falls Short in Construction Equipment Marketing
- Construction equipment markets have shifted. Customer needs evolve rapidly with new regulations, tech, and project demands.
- Old VoC programs rely on annual surveys and sales data — too slow for innovation cycles.
- Managers struggle to extract actionable insights because data is siloed or outdated.
- A 2024 IDC report showed 46% of industrial marketers missed key product improvement opportunities due to delayed customer feedback.
- For Wix users, standard forms and feedback apps often lack customization for complex buyer personas and project-specific questions.

Continuous Feedback: Faster, More Relevant Input
- Delegate feedback gathering to field sales and service teams who engage daily.
- Use brief, targeted questions post-equipment demo or repair.
- Example: One construction equipment firm using Zigpoll via Wix increased response rates from 18% to 52% by integrating polls into service update pages.
- Sales leads test targeted questions about digital tool adoption, reporting back weekly.
- Avoid generic surveys; customize by project type (e.g., heavy earthmoving vs. finishing equipment).
Experimentation Loop: Test, Learn, Refine
- Marketing teams own rapid experiments on product messaging, offers, or content.
- Use Wix’s A/B testing to trial headlines emphasizing uptime vs. fuel efficiency.
- Example: A team testing messaging around electric excavators saw click-through rates rise from 2% to 11% after three iterations.
- Incorporate field data—feedback on new features—into messaging tweaks.
- Caveat: Requires fast coordination across sales, marketing, and product to keep feedback loops tight.

Emerging Analytics: Extract Meaning from Volume
- AI sentiment analysis tools parse open-ended responses to surface key themes.
- For example, operators might mention “hydraulic lag” or “cab noise” repeatedly; alerts prioritize fixes.
- Wix supports AI app plugins for automated tagging and trend spotting.
- Data from online feedback combined with IoT telematics for deeper understanding.
- Limitation: AI is only as good as training data—construction jargon and slang require custom tuning.
How to Measure Success
- Track conversion lift on digital campaigns linked to VoC-driven messaging.
- Monitor customer satisfaction (CSAT) scores post-interaction; aim for 10% improvement year-over-year.
- Use engagement metrics on Wix-hosted feedback forms—higher completion signals relevance.
- Pilot teams report faster product iterations; e.g., one team halved time from feedback to deployment after adopting continuous VoC.
- Beware of over-relying on quantitative scores; balance with qualitative insights for nuance.
